Campbell allowed five goals on 26 shots in the Kings loss in Chicago on Sunday. Campbell had a nice start to the season but has stumbled as of late, losing his last three starts while posting a 3.04 GAA and .875 SV%. Tonight he faces a Chicago team that has lost five of their last six (1-4-1) while averaging just 1.67 goals per game.




Francouz gave up four goals on 26 shots in Colorado's loss to the Ducks last Saturday. Francouz has played very sparingly early in the season but has played well when called upon--2-1-0 with a 2.63 GAA and .926 SV%. Tonight he faces a Coyotes team that is 7-4-1 while averaging 2.83 goals per game (19th in the NHL).

Sautner will replace Quinn Hughes, who is day-to-day with a bruised knee. Sautner has three assists in 22 career NHL games and picked up one assist in four AHL games before being called-up.

Hughes left Friday's game with a lower-body injury and has officially been ruled out of Saturday's game in San Jose. Ashton Sautner will replace him in the lineup for at least one game.

Demko allowed two goals on 31 shots in the Canucks win over the Panthers on Monday. Jacob Markstrom started the last two games, including last night, so Demko will make his fifth start tonight. He is 3-1-0 with a 1.73 GAA and .941 SV% in his first four starts and gets a crack at a struggling Sharks team that sits 27th in goal-scoring (2.43 GF/gm) in their first 14 games.




Allen allowed four goals on 24 shots in the Blues loss to the Canadiens on October 19th. Allen missed a start last weekend due to an illness but will make his third start of the season on Saturday evening. He has allowed four goals in each of his starts while posting a .849 SV%, but a matchup with the Wild keeps him in the spot-start conversation on Saturday.

Bernier allowed one goal on 12 shots in the Red Wings loss in Carolina last night. With Jimmy Howard stumbling, Bernier will go tonight in Florida and look to snap a four-game personal losing streak. The Panthers currently rank fifth in the league in goal scoring (3.54 GF/gm) so look elsewhere for goalie options tonight.

Varlamov surrendered three goals on 31 shots in the Islanders win over the Flyers last Sunday. Thomas Greiss started last night so look for Varlamov to get the second game of their back-to-back in Buffalo. He comes into play on a four-game winning streak, posting a 1.96 GAA and .935 SV% in the process. He is a good option whenever the Islanders call on him.

Korpisalo was pulled after allowing four goals on 12 shots in the Blue Jackets loss to the Oilers on Wednesday. With Elvis Merzlikins starting last night, head coach John Tortorella will tab Korpisalo for tonight's game vs. the Flames. Calgary has lost three of five and rank 21st in the NHL in offence (2.73 GF/gm) though 15 games.

Price allowed one goal on 33 shots in the Canadiens win in Arizona on Wednesday. Keith Kinkaid got the nod on Thursday, so Price will likely start Saturday night in Dallas. Price has won four of his last five while posting an impressive 1.82 GAA, .935 SV% and one shutout. Price is playing very well but the Stars come in having won five of their last six, so they're hot as well.
